1. Kuta Beach

Kuta Beach is arguably Bali’s most famous beach, known for its long stretches of golden sand and lively atmosphere. This beach is perfect for those who enjoy surfing, sunbathing, and vibrant nightlife. With numerous bars and restaurants lining the shore, you can easily spend a whole day here soaking up the sun.

2. Seminyak Beach

Just north of Kuta, Seminyak Beach offers a more upscale experience. With luxurious resorts, trendy beach clubs, and chic boutiques, it’s a great spot for those looking to indulge. 3. Nusa Dua Beach

Nusa Dua Beach is perfect for families and those seeking a more tranquil environment. Its calm waters make it ideal for swimming and snorkeling. The beach is well-maintained and surrounded by luxurious resorts, making it a great place to relax and unwind.

4. Padang Padang Beach

Famous for its surf breaks and stunning rock formations, Padang Padang Beach is a hidden gem. This small beach can be accessed through a set of stairs, which adds to its charm. It’s a great spot to relax, sunbathe, or catch some waves if you’re a surfing enthusiast.

5. Jimbaran Beach

Known for its seafood restaurants that line the shore, Jimbaran Beach is the perfect place for a romantic dinner at sunset. Enjoy freshly grilled fish while listening to the waves lapping at the shore. It’s a great way to experience the local cuisine while enjoying the beautiful Bali sunsets.

6. Sanur Beach

Sanur Beach offers a more laid-back vibe compared to the bustling Kuta and Seminyak. With calm waters and a lovely promenade, it’s a great spot for families and those who enjoy a peaceful day by the sea. Renting a bike to explore the area is also a popular option here.

7. Amed Beach

Amed Beach is a quieter, more secluded spot on the eastern coast of Bali. Known for its black volcanic sand and excellent snorkeling opportunities, Amed is perfect for those looking to escape the crowds. Explore the vibrant underwater life or simply relax on the beach.

8. Lovina Beach

Lovina Beach, located in North Bali, is famous for its black sand beaches and calm waters. It’s also the best spot for dolphin watching. Early morning boat trips are popular here, allowing you to witness these playful creatures in their natural habitat.

9. Bingin Beach

Bingin Beach is a picturesque spot that’s favored by surfers and beach lovers. With its stunning cliffs and clear waters, it’s the perfect place to enjoy a day of sun and surf. Make sure to check the tides, as this beach can be tricky to access at high tide.

10. Dreamland Beach

Last but not least, Dreamland Beach is known for its beautiful scenery and excellent surf conditions. It’s a great place to relax, catch some waves, or simply enjoy the view. The beach has several local warungs where you can grab a bite to eat while soaking in the sun.
